Course Content

• Nanotechnology Fundamentals and Applications
• Nanobiotechnology: Principles and Techniques
• Nanomaterials for Biomedical Applications (including toxicity and safety)
• Ethical, Legal, and Societal Implications (ELSI) of Nanobiotechnology
• Nanobiotechnology Policy and Regulation
• Risk Assessment and Management of Nanomaterials
• Science Communication and Public Engagement with Nanobiotechnology
• Data Analysis and Interpretation for Nanobiotechnology Policy
• Case Studies in Nanobiotechnology Policy

Career path

Career Role (Nanobiology Policy) Description
Regulatory Affairs Specialist (Nanomaterials) Develops and implements policies concerning the safe use and regulation of nanomaterials in various sectors. High demand due to increasing nanotechnology applications.
Science Policy Advisor (Nanobiotechnology) Advises government bodies and organizations on the ethical, societal, and economic implications of nanobiotechnology advancements. Requires strong analytical and communication skills.
Nanotechnology Risk Assessor Evaluates the potential risks associated with nanomaterials and nanotechnology applications to human health and the environment. Growing field with significant future potential.
Biotechnology Consultant (Nanomedicine Policy) Provides expert advice on the policy implications of nanomedicine advancements, including clinical trials, commercialization, and ethical considerations.
